Koraput Junction railway station, located in the Indian state of Odisha, serves Koraput town in Koraput district.

Contents

History

In 1960, Indian Railway took up three projects: the Kottavalasa-Koraput-Jeypore-Kirandaul line ( Dandakaranya Project ), the Titlagarh-Bolangir-Jharsuguda Project and the Rourkela-Kiriburu Project. All the three projects taken together were popularly known as the DBK Project or the Dandakaranya Bolangir Kiriburu Project. [1]

The Koraput-Rayagada Rail Link Project was completed on 31 December 1998. [2]

Trains

Koraput - Visakhapatnam Intercity express Koraput Intercity express arrives at Visakhapatnam.jpg
Koraput - Visakhapatnam Intercity express

The Visakhapatnam-Kirandul Passenger passes through Koraput. The Hirakhand Express connects Koraput to Bhubaneswar via Rayagada and Vizianagaram. Howrah-Koraput Samaleshwari Express travels via Jharsuguda, Sambalpur and Rayagada. The Durg-Jagdalpur Tri-Weekly Express travels via Titlagarh, Rayagada and Koraput.

Passenger movement

Koraput railway station serves around 27,000 passengers every day.

Jharsuguda–Vizianagaram line

The Jharsuguda–Vizianagaram line is a railway line in eastern India. It connects Jharsuguda, on the Howrah-Nagpur-Mumbai line, and Titlagarh, which in turn is connected with Vizianagaram, on the Howrah-Chennai main line, and Raipur, on the Howrah-Nagpur-Mumbai line. There are several branch lines, like the one connecting Rayagada with Koraput on the Kothavalasa-Kirandul line. The line traverses western Odisha and connects the Howrah-Nagpur-Mumbai line with the Howrah-Chennai main line. It covers small portions of Chhattisgarh and Andhra Pradesh.

Hirakhand express Hirakhand Express is a daily express train which was initially introduced between Sambalpur and Balangir but now runs between Jagdalpur and Bhubaneswar.

Hirakhand Express is a daily express train which runs between Jagdalpur and Bhubaneswar. It was initially introduced between Rayagada and Bhubaneswar via Vizianagaram, but later extended to Koraput after completion of the Koraput-Rayagada link line connecting Jharsuguda-Vizianagaram line with Kothavalasa-Kirandul line. In 2010, it was further extended till Jagdalpur. It is operated by the East Coast Railway Zone of Indian Railways.

The Dandakaranya Project, or the DNK Project, was the form of action the Indian government designed in September 1958 for the settlement of displaced persons from Bangladesh and for integrated development of the area with particular regard to the promotion of the interests of the local tribal population. The particular focus was on Bengali refugees from East Pakistan moving to lands and resources in Odisha and Chhattisgarh. To implement this project, the Government of India established the Dandakaranya Development Authority.
